Hannah Laing, Queen of the Doof

Hannah Laing started DJing at 18 years old. Growing up in a household that loved rave culture, she was deeply influenced by the house and trance sounds that would shape her career. As she was cutting her teeth in the local scene, she took up working as a dental nurse during the day while playing at clubs in her hometown Dundee, Scotland at night.

In 2019 her bootleg of Sophie Ellis-Bextor's 'Murder on the Dancefloor' garnered support from top DJs like FISHER and Peggy Gou, bringing Hannah Laing wider recognition.

Her time as a resident DJ in Ibiza, performing at world-renowned clubs like DC-10, Amnesia, and Hï, helped Hannah develop a loyal, dedicated fanbase and gave her the space to craft her signature style.

Since 2021, Hannah has been rapidly ascending through the ranks with releases on major labels like Jax Jone's WUGD, Solardo’s Sola, Patrick Topping's TRICK, and Spinnin' Records. Her 2023 single 'Good Love' with RoRo accumulated millions of streams and became her first UK top 10 hit.

Following the single's success, Hannah Laing launched her own record label Doof in 2023. The creation of Doof marks a major milestone in Hannah's career, as it allows her to showcase not only her music but also emerging talent in the UK dance music scene.

In the Summer's of 2023 and 2024, Hannah Laing performed at some of the biggest festivals across the UK, including Creamfields, TRNSMT, and Glastonbury, further establishing herself as a major force in the electronic music world. Her high-energy sets, combining hard house, bouncy techno, and rave elements, continue to captivate audiences.

Hannah Laing's 2024 EP, Into the Doof, showcases her unique sound. Released under her own label, Doof, the EP is a reflection of her evolving style and a testament to her growth as both a DJ and producer.

2024 continues to see Hannah build momentum. She's hosting her own curated Doof night at The Warehouse Project in Manchester and an homecoming gig in Dundee; Doof in the Park.

Hannah Laing is a Scottish DJ and producer known for her energetic blend of house and techno music. Emerging from Dundee, she gained recognition with her bootleg of 'Murder on the Dancefloor' and hit tracks like 'Good Love.' In 2023, she launched her record label, Doof.

Hannah Laing combines elements of house, hard house, techno, and a sprinkle of trance that appeals to dance music fans of all ages. With her energetic beats and catchy melodies, Hannah Laing has been praised for breathing new life her 90s raver parents influences and creating her own unique signature sound.

Hannah Laing is originally from Dundee, Scotland. Raised by raver parents in the 90s, she developed a deep connection to electronic music, which has significantly influenced her career as a DJ and producer. Her roots in Dundee play a vital role in her artistic identity, contributing to her local fanbase and her performances in the area.

In 2023, Hannah Laing launched her label Doof, a significant milestone in her career, allowing her to not only showcase her own music but also to support emerging talent within the UK dance music scene.

Speaking to the BBC on the name, Hannah Laing said “Everyone would ask what kind of music I play, and in Scotland, we say ‘doof’ for banging music, and in Australia, ‘doof’ means ‘party’ - So when I was launching my label, I thought there’s no better fitting name."

Hannah has established herself in the festival circuit, performing at major events like Creamfields, TRNSMT, and Glastonbury during the summers of 2023 and 2024. She also has her own curated Doof night with The Warehouse Project.

Celebrating her roots, Doof in the Park is an exciting event hosted by Hannah Laing in her hometown of Dundee. The event fouses on music and community and features an eclectic lineup of artists and DJs, curated by Hannah Laing, with the house and techno star headlining the evening.
